I'm trying to edit the manifest.sii file and 7zip doesn't seem to let me just delete the original and add the replacement file; I either get a "operation is not supported" or an "unknown command" error if I either try to open the file inside the archive or try to add the replacement. Is there anyway to actually go and do that without unzipping all of the files and rezipping them again just to change a single solitary line in a small text file? This isn't a problem that I've ever had before with 7zip, and its incredibly annoying...

What exactly are you trying to do? If you're trying to make the ferry connection compatible, just open manifest.sii within the compressed archive, remove the compatibility statement line, save and exit.
